Grilled Cajun Shrimp Skewers Recipe

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 6 minutes
  • Total Time: 21 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ings
  • Category: Main Course, Appetizer
  • Method: Grilling
  • Cuisine: Cajun, American
  • Diet: Gluten Free

Description

Delicious and easy-to-make Grilled Cajun Shrimp Skewers featuring succulent large shrimp marinated in a flavorful blend of Cajun seasoning, smoked paprika, garlic, and lemon juice. Perfectly grilled to a smoky char, these skewers make an ideal main course or appetizer for summer BBQs and gatherings.


Ingredients

Shrimp and Marinade

  • 1 pound large shrimp (peeled and deveined, tails on)
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on Cajun seasoning
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• ½ teaspoon onion powder
  • ¼ te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ice

Additional

  • Wooden or metal skewers
  • Optional: fresh parsley for garnish
  • Optional: lemon wedges for garnish


Instructions

  1. Soak Skewers: If using wooden skewers, soak them in water for at least 20 minutes to prevent burning on the grill.
  2. Marinate Shrimp: In a large bowl, toss the shrimp with olive oil, Cajun seasoning, smoked pa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, black pepper, and lemon juice. Allow the shrimp to marinate for 15–20 minutes so the flavors infuse.
  3. Thread Shrimp: Thread about 4–5 shrimp per skewer carefully, ensuring they are evenly spaced.
  4. Preheat Grill: Preheat your grill to medium-high heat and lightly oil the grates or spray with a grill-safe non-stick spray to prevent sticking.
  5. Grill Shrimp: Place the shrimp skewers on the grill and cook for 2–3 minutes per side, turning them once, until shrimp are pink, opaque, and slightly charred.
  6. Serve: Remove the shrimp skewers from the grill and serve immediately garnished with fresh chopped parsley and lemon wedges if desired.

Notes

  • Serve with rice, grilled vegetables, or on a fresh salad for a complete meal.
  • For extra heat, add a pinch of cayenne pepper to the marinade.
  • Ensure shrimp are cooked just until opaque to avoid rubbery texture.
  • If wooden skewers are not soaked well, they might burn on the grill.
